Community Tasting Notes (3) Median Score: 92 points

  • Gold coloured. Astonishing concentration and complexity on both the nose and palate. Notes of honey, marzipan, almond, dried apricots and a touch of fig.

    Nice and dry. There were layers of complexity showing and balanced with fresh fresh acidity despite the maturity of the wine.

    This honestly blew me away and was a favourite of the evening around the table.

RJonWine.com

  • By Richard Jennings
    9/6/2012, (See more on RJonWine.com...) 92 points

    (Domaine des Comtes Lafon Puligny-Montrachet 1er Cru Les Champs-Gain) Light lemon yellow color; waxy, lanolin, oak, tart lemon nose; mature, ripe lemon, mineral, apple palate; medium-plus finish 92+ points
  • By Richard Jennings
    3/21/2003, (See more on RJonWine.com...) 92 points

    (Domaine des Comtes Lafon Puligny-Montrachet 1er Cru Les Champs-Gain) Reticent nose; oily textured, rich, mineral, butter palate with good acidity; medium-plus finish
